Ferris wheel shuts after generator catches fire

A big wheel has been forced to temporarily halt turning after being engulfed in smoke when its generator caught fire two days after opening.

The infrastructure of the Ripon Big Sky Wheel caught fire at around 15:00 BST on Monday, according to North Yorkshire Fire and Rescue.

It was extinguished using a bucket of water before the fire service arrived.

The wheel will be closed for the rest of the day and everyone on the attraction at the time has been offered a free replacement ride, according to Visit Ripon.

North Yorkshire Council previously said it hoped the wheel would boost footfall in the city and offer visitors a new angle on Ripon Cathedral, Fountains Abbey and the surrounding hills.
